Promising the industry's highest level of security, the DS3644 security manager employs a patented memory scheme consisting of 1,024 bytes of non-imprinting memory. Internal tamper monitors protect against clock, electrical, and temperature tampering while tamper-detection inputs for external sensors enable complete customization. Non-imprinting memory allows users to selectively clear the memory based on user-specified tamper events. The patented memory scheme also ensures immediate data erasure in response to tampering, thus improving system security over SRAM-based designs. Available in a 49-ball, 7 mm x 7 mm CSBGA, pricing is available upon request after a mutual NDA is completed. MAXIM INTEGRATED PRODUCTS, Sunnyvale, CA. (800) 998-8800.
